    Clarke Community School District has an opening for a Middle School ELL with ELA Preferred Teacher for the 2025-2026 school year. A current Iowa teaching license with appropriate endorsements (or willing to obtain) are required for this position.

     

    Coaching opportunities are also available.

     

    The Clarke Community School District reserves the right to close this position without notice, or extend the deadline!

    PERFORMANCE RESPONSIBILITIES:

    + Provide EL push in and/or pull out instruction to students in elementary grades.

    + Assist in administering required language proficiency and academic achievement tests for determining placement for students in grades PreK and up, along with ongoing monitoring of student progress.

    + Maintain database of EL and EL-eligible students.

    + Assist in developing language acquisition support plans (EL plans) for all EL students and work with classroom teachers to implement plans.

    + Assist in completing EL Accommodations Forms and EL Progress Reports for elementary school students.

    + Work with classroom teachers to support differentiated instruction.

    + Assist in developing appropriate curriculum to help EL students acquire the English language.

    + Employ a variety of instructional techniques and teaching strategies to meet different aptitudes and interests of students, including whole group (co-teaching)/small-group or individual learning.

    + Assist in gathering and reporting data for reporting requirements and other required reports (to the State, Charter School Board, Dept. of Education, census, grant applications, annual report, etc.).

    + Establish and maintain communication with parents of students in the program.

    + Engage parents and families in their student's learning and acting as an ambassador for the school in the community.

    + Contribute productively to the school as a whole.

    + Participate in in-service and staff development activities and staff meetings as required or assigned.

    + Attend IEP, Section 504, or other related meetings necessary for student assessment and/or compliance with federal and/or state law.

    + Attend and participate in established traditional school-sponsored activities (i.e., back-to school night, open house, and other activities customarily attended by classroom teachers and/or faculty members), which may be outside of regular school hours.
